About Nokia
Nokia, founded in 1865 in Finland, began as a paper mill and evolved into a global telecommunications giant. Initially producing various industrial goods, it rose to fame in the late 20th century as a leader in mobile phones, known for durable, user-friendly devices. Today, Nokia focuses on telecommunications infrastructure, including 5G networks, and licenses its brand for smartphones. Renowned for innovation and reliability, it holds a strong market reputation for quality and resilience, transitioning from a consumer electronics icon to a key player in network technology.
